'Carers are among the most sacrificial and unsung heroes of our society. In a variety of extremely difficult circumstances and at considerable financial and personal cost, they give of themselves to an extent which most of us would find it hard to imagine. I am therefore delighted to give my support to Carers Week promoted by local charities the Princess Royal Trust for Carers, Carers Northern Ireland, Macmillan and Parkinsons. I hope that it has the effect of bringing the role of carers into sharper focus - not only during this week, but in the weeks to come.' Allan Bresland, MLA

'I have signed the House of Commons, Early Day Motion on Carers tabled by Tony Baldry MP. I have also made representations directly to the Minister for Health in Northern Ireland requesting a reform of the care and suppor system in order for carers to be able to access support they deserve at times of crisis.' Margaret Ritchie MP, MLA
